The Chair introduced the Members of the Sub-Committee together with the Solicitor, the Senior Licensing Officer and the Democratic Services Officer.

 

The Solicitor stated that the application submitted for the variation of the premises licence failed to address the removal of a condition which was fundamental to the variation being sought. The applicant therefore agreed to withdraw its application and to submit a new application to clearly detail their intentions following a pre-application discussion with the Licensing Authority and the Devon and Cornwall Constabulary.

 

Neythan Hayes confirmed the application was withdrawn.

 

RESOLVED that the application be withdrawn.
